G
Guest
Gast
Hi Ho
ich bin nue hier und stresse euch gleich sry
Aber brauche eure hilfe:
Habe paar fragen bekommen und nun wollt ich von euch wissen ob meine antwortensoweit in ordnung sind
meine antworten dazu
Kann man das so schreiben / stimmt das alles?
Ist wichtig für mich das das alles stimmt ^^
Seid ihr so nett und schaut da mal drüber.
ich bin nue hier und stresse euch gleich sry
Aber brauche eure hilfe:
Habe paar fragen bekommen und nun wollt ich von euch wissen ob meine antwortensoweit in ordnung sind
Code:
eine methode wird als synchronized deklariert:
public void synchronized bla() {}
Was wird synchronisiert ?
a) der aktuelle Thread
b) die Klasse, in der die Methode ist
c) alle Aufrufe der Methode
d) das aktuelle Objekt (die Instanz) der Klasse, in der die Methode ist
e) gar nichts
meine antworten dazu
Code:
1)
a) der aktuelle Thread
Ein Thread wird nicht synchronisiert
b) die Klasse, in der die Methode ist
Nein die Klasse wird dadurch nicht synchronisiert
c) alle Aufrufe der Methode
Richtig, alles was die Methode enthält ist synchronisiert.
d) das aktuelle Objekt (die Instanz) der Klasse, in der die Methode ist
Nein das aktuelle Objekt der Klasse ist dadurch nicht synchronisiert.
e) gar nichts
Nein, es sind alle Aufrufe die die Methode macht synchronisiert.
Kann man das so schreiben / stimmt das alles?
Ist wichtig für mich das das alles stimmt ^^
Seid ihr so nett und schaut da mal drüber.